编程统计方法与技巧解析

编程统计是一种利用计算机编程实现数据分析、数据处理和数据可视化的方法。在现代社会中,数据成为了各行业决策的重要依据,因此掌握编程统计方法和技巧对于提高工作效率和解决问题至关重要。本文将介绍编程统计的基本概念、常用编程工具和具体编程技巧,以帮助读者更好地进行数据处理和分析。

1. 编程统计的基本概念

编程统计是将统计学与计算机科学相结合的一种方法。它主要利用计算机编程语言(例如Python、R等)进行数据处理、分析和可视化。编程统计的优势在于能够处理大规模的数据集,自动化处理流程,提供灵活的数据处理和分析方法。

2. 常用编程工具

在编程统计过程中,选择合适的编程工具是非常重要的。以下是一些常用的编程工具:

Python:Python是一种简洁、易学且功能丰富的编程语言,拥有强大的科学计算库(例如NumPy、Pandas和Matplotlib),适用于数据处理和分析。

R:R是一种专门用于统计计算和绘图的语言,拥有大量的统计分析库(例如dplyr、ggplot2和lme4),广泛应用于统计学和数据科学领域。

SQL:SQL是结构化查询语言,主要用于管理和处理关系型数据库。在大规模数据处理和数据分析中,使用SQL可以高效地提取和整理数据。

Excel:Excel是一种常见的办公软件,也可用于简单的数据统计和分析。它提供了一些基本的统计函数和图表功能。

3. 编程统计的基本步骤

编程统计通常包含以下几个基本步骤:

数据获取:从各种数据源(例如文件、数据库、API等)中获取需要分析的数据。

数据清洗:对获取的数据进行清洗和预处理,包括处理缺失值、重复值、异常值等。

数据分析:根据具体问题选择合适的统计方法,例如描述性统计、假设检验、回归分析等。

数据可视化:利用适当的图表和可视化工具将数据结果展示出来,以加深对数据的理解。

结果解释:对分析结果进行解释,提出相应的结论和建议。

4. 编程统计的技巧和建议

在进行编程统计时,有一些技巧和建议可以帮助提高效率和准确性:

学习编程语言和库:深入了解所使用的编程语言和相关库的功能和用法,熟练掌握常用的数据处理和统计方法。

使用函数和模块:将常用的数据处理和统计操作封装成函数和模块,以便复用和提高代码的可读性。

数据可视化:利用适当的图表和可视化工具将数据结果进行可视化,可以更直观地理解数据的特征和规律。

代码注释和文档:在编程过程中,及时添加代码注释和编写文档,以便他人能够理解和使用你的代码。

不断学习和实践:统计学和编程技术都是不断发展和更新的领域,保持

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

最近发表

艾畅

这家伙太懒。。。

  • 暂无未发布任何投稿。